After about 5 minutes, gently shake the pan ...The part of the flour's weight that's protein is divided by the whole weight of the serving (usually 30 grams). The result is the percentage of protein in the flour. Our Unbleached Bread Flour has 12.7% protein, which equals 3.81g protein/30g flour. Our Unbleached All-Purpose Flour has 11.7% protein, which equals 3.51g of protein/30g …There are a variety of weight-to-volume conversions online for flour, with considerable variation even among reputable sources: King Arthur Flour says 4.25oz/cup but in their measuring tips article says it's 4oz/cup when sifted, up to 5.5oz/cup when scooped, and yet that somehow 4.25oz/cup is "closer to what bakers actually measure volume-wise".. Ingredient Weight Chart For best results, we recommend weighing your ingredients with a digital scale. A cup of all-purpose flour weighs 4 1/4 ounces or 120 grams. Measure out 113g (1/2 cup) of the starter; discard the rest (or bake something with it). Feed this 113g of starter with 113g each water and flour. Cover it and let it rest on the counter until it starts bubbling (1 to 2 hours) before returning it to the refrigerator.The basic all-purpose flour/liquid ratio is 2 1/2 to 3 cups flour to 1 1/4 cups liquid, depending on the time of year -- more flour in the summer, less in the winter. Bread that rises, then collapses in the middle as it bakes -- the infamous “crater bread” -- contains too much liquid. Adjust your formula. Our higher-gluten bread flour delivers consistent, dependable results.To make matter worse, David Lebovitz, whom I follow, posted that he has his own weight conversions and recommended King Arthurs's conversion chart which is 120 grams per cup of their all purpose or bread flour. That is 20 grams off of the normal 140 grams or 5 ounces per cup that most professionals use as standard.

Compare the weights of the other ingredients to flour. To determine the percentage of the other ingredients, divide each one by the weight of the flour (177g), then multiply the result (which is in decimal form) by 100 to convert it to a percent: • The shortening (46g) is 26% of the flour, by weight: (46 ÷ 177) x 100 = 26%. cap and ball derringer This eco-friendly and easy-to-clean pan is manufactured from a mix of steel (for strength and durability), and aluminum (for superior conductivity).
